Armored Fiber Optic Cables
Armored Fiber Optic Cables are precisely designed for out of doors and rugged environments where they must endure physical stress, rodent attacks, and severe climatic conditions. These cables feature a layer of metal or aluminum armor that guards the fragile fibers within.

Essential Characteristics:
Steel Tape Armored Fiber Cable: Supplies exceptional safety from exterior impacts.
Aluminium Armored Fiber Cable: Light-weight solution, also presenting solid defense.
Outside Armored Fiber Optic Cable: Suited for out of doors installations, normally buried underground.

Well-liked Armored Fiber Cable Models:
GYXTW 6B1 & GYXTW 12B1: These are generally utilised duct optical fiber cables with steel wire armor for out of doors installations.
GYFTY 12B1 & GYFTY 24B1: Lightweight armored cables, fitted to outside aerial or duct installations. GYFTY cables have non-metallic strength users, generating them ideal for parts at risk of electrical interference.

ADSS Fiber Optic Cables
ADSS (All-Dielectric Self-Supporting) cables are suitable for aerial installations without the will need to get a supporting messenger wire. These cables are solid adequate to face up to environmental stresses like wind and ice but stay light-weight and free from metallic factors, earning them ideal for high-voltage parts.

Important Characteristics:
Adss Fall Cable: Perfect for short-span installations, for example in suburban or rural spots.
ADSS Fiber Optical Cable: Designed for more time spans, typically employed for prime-voltage ability strains.

ADSS Pole Attachment Hardware: Consists of anchor clamps, suspension models, and useless ends accustomed to safe the cable alongside its route.
Common Hardware:
Preformed Male Grips & ADSS Cable Pressure Clamps: Accustomed to safe and provide tension on ADSS cables in aerial installations.
ADSS Suspension Units: Offer help for prolonged-span ADSS cables.
Programs:
Aerial installations: ADSS cables are set up along utility poles without having further guidance, earning them cost-effective for telecommunications providers.
Superior-voltage environments: Non-metallic design ensures safety and minimizes interference in spots with electrical strains.
OPGW (Optical Ground Wire) Cables
OPGW (Optical Ground Fibra Optica Adss 12 Hilos Wire) cables Incorporate the features of grounding and conversation. These cables are installed together substantial-voltage electricity traces and act as both a lightning protect and also a fiber optic conversation link.

Vital Capabilities:
Opgw Conductor: Features as both a grounding wire and an optical interaction cable.
Optical Ground Wire OPGW: Has optical fibers for details transmission and steel for grounding.

Purposes:
Electric power utilities: OPGW cables are deployed along transmission traces to protect from lightning strikes although at the same time supporting large-velocity information transmission.
Telecommunication: These cables offer a dependable connection for remote and rural knowledge networks.
